The LoTi Digital-Age Survey—based on Moersch’s LoTi Framework (1994)—is an empirically-validated tool that creates a personalized digital-age professional development profile for participants aligned to the NETS for Teachers (NETS-T) and Administrators (NETS-A). Since its inception in 1994, the LoTi Framework has been used as the basis for (1) statewide technology use surveys, (2) LoTi’s Digital-Age School improvement model, and (3) a classroom walkthrough tool impacting thousands of schools nationally.

Research
The LoTi assessment has undergone extensive research over the past 20 years and has emerged as a statistically-valid tool achieving (1) content, (2) construct, and (3) criterion validity; therefore proving that the LoTi assessment can be used to accurately diagnose instructional uses of technology and recommend professional development priorities consistent with 21st Century Skills and the NETS-T and NETS-A.

Results
The survey results include a detailed profile of suggested professional development priorities aligned to the NETS-T and NETS-A. In addition, this profile offers recommendations aligned to five popular instructional initiatives including (1) Level of Teaching Innovation (LoTi), (2) Partnership for 21st Century Skills, (3) Marzano’s Research-based Instructional Practices, (4) Daggett’s Rigor & Relevance, and (5) Webb’s Depth of Knowledge. As with all LoTi surveys, past and present, participants will also receive a separate Level of Teaching Innovation (LoTi), Current Instructional Practices (CIP), and Personal Computer Use (PCU) score.
